Materials And Construction

The Avocado mattress uses organic latex, wool, and cotton. These materials are natural and free from harmful chemicals. The mattress has layers that work together for comfort. The latex layer provides bounce and pressure relief. Wool helps with temperature control and moisture. Cotton covers the mattress for softness and breathability. The construction is sturdy and built to last.

Firmness And Support

This mattress offers a firm feel that supports the spine. It helps keep the body aligned during sleep. The latex layer gives a slight bounce for easy movement. It works well for back and stomach sleepers. Side sleepers may find it firm but still comfortable. The support reduces aches and improves sleep quality.

Eco-friendly Aspects

The Avocado mattress uses sustainable and renewable materials. It avoids synthetic foams that harm the environment. The wool is organic and pesticide-free. The cotton cover is GOTS certified for organic farming. The mattress is handmade in the USA to reduce carbon footprint. It is also certified by third parties for safety and health standards.

Warranty And Trial Period

Avocado offers a 25-year warranty for this mattress. This shows confidence in its durability and quality. Customers get a 100-night trial to test the mattress at home. Returns are simple if the mattress does not meet expectations. This trial period helps buyers feel secure about their purchase.

Nest Mattress Features

The Nest Mattress offers several features that make it stand out. It focuses on comfort, support, and durability. Understanding these features helps you decide if it suits your sleep needs.

Materials And Construction

The Nest Mattress uses high-quality foam layers for comfort. Its top layer is soft and adapts to your body shape. Beneath, firmer foams provide strong support. The mattress cover is breathable and gentle to the skin. This mix of materials aims to balance softness and support well.

Firmness And Support

The mattress offers a medium-firm feel. It supports the spine and reduces pressure points. This firmness suits many sleep positions. It helps keep your body aligned all night. People who prefer balanced comfort often like this mattress.

Cooling Technology

The Nest Mattress includes cooling foam to reduce heat. It allows air to flow through the mattress. This helps keep you cool during sleep. The breathable cover also adds to the cooling effect. Together, these features help prevent overheating.

Warranty And Trial Period

The mattress comes with a 10-year warranty. This covers defects and problems with materials. Nest offers a 100-night trial period. This lets you test the mattress at home. You can return it if it does not fit your needs.

Pressure Relief

Avocado mattress uses natural latex and organic wool for soft support. It gently cushions pressure points like hips and shoulders. This helps reduce pain and improves sleep quality.

Nest mattress offers memory foam layers that contour closely to your body. It provides excellent pressure relief, especially for side sleepers. The foam absorbs weight and eases tension.

Motion Isolation

Avocado’s latex and coil design absorbs some movement but transfers more than memory foam. It works well for light sleepers but may feel a bit bouncy.

Nest mattress excels in motion isolation. Its memory foam layers limit motion transfer well. Ideal for couples who wake easily from partner movement.

Edge Support

Avocado has strong edge support thanks to its coil system. You can sit or sleep near the edge without feeling like you might fall off.

Nest mattress provides decent edge support but may feel softer at the sides. Better suited for those who stay mostly in the center of the bed.

Suitability For Different Sleep Positions

Avocado is best for back and stomach sleepers. It offers firm support and keeps the spine aligned.

Nest mattress suits side sleepers well. Its soft memory foam cushions curves and relieves pressure.

Longevity Of Materials

Avocado mattresses use natural latex, organic cotton, and wool. These materials resist sagging and keep shape over time. Latex is known for its bounce and durability. Nest mattresses blend memory foam and pocketed coils. High-quality foams last several years but may soften faster than latex. Coils add support and help with mattress life. Overall, Avocado’s natural materials often outlast synthetic foams.

Cleaning And Care

Avocado covers are removable and washable. Organic cotton helps resist dust and allergens naturally. Wool inside regulates moisture and reduces odor. Nest mattress covers are not removable in most models. Spot cleaning is recommended for Nest mattresses. Both brands suggest using mattress protectors to keep dirt away. Regular airing and vacuuming extend mattress freshness for both.

Resistance To Wear And Tear

Avocado mattresses handle daily wear well due to firm latex layers. They bounce back quickly from pressure. Nest mattresses may show indentations faster because of foam layers. The coil system in Nest adds durability but depends on use. Both mattresses resist dust mites and allergens effectively. Avocado’s natural fibers provide extra protection against moisture damage.
